Pet Subject is an inclusive brand for large-breed dogs, dedicated to breaking stereotypes. It blends functionality with creativity to foster understanding and inclusivity.
• Balancing practical pet needs with an artistic, stereotype-breaking mission.
• Creating an emotionally resonant identity that stands out.
• Designing a system adaptable for artist collaborations.
Under the creative direction of project ×, a platform connecting talents, brands, and agencies worldwide, the goal was to craft a brand identity that embodies inclusivity, artistry, and care. The design aimed to craft a brand identity that’s both loving and artistic, appealing to pet owners seeking thoughtful, well-designed products with a meaningful message.
• A creative identity that resonates with pet owners and artists.
• Differentiation through artistic branding in a saturated market.
• A visual system supporting collaborations and fostering inclusivity.
• Concept Development: The identity highlights pets as subjects of care and art, blending craftsmanship with creativity.
• Logo Design: A hand-drawn logo with organic, imperfect lines symbolizes the individuality of pets and the creative process.
• Color Palette & Typography: Neutral tones with bold accents balance warmth and creativity, paired with a modern sans-serif font for personality.
• Inspiration: Handmade ceramics and textiles informed the visual identity, supporting artistic collaborations and addressing stereotypes.
